Scranton or Wilkes-Barre or any place in between are much cheaper to live than national average and ae very close to I-84 and I-380 the four lane connection to Tobyhanna. More than 1/2 of depot employees live in Luzerne or Lackawanna Counties. You must be leqaving Indiantown Gap? I moved from the Poconos to Annville. Big change in terrain and culture. Poconos are bedroom community for NJ & NY. Lebanon County, as you are aware, is still farm country, I mean endless corn fields populated by those who have lived here for generations. I call them the 'landed gentry.'
